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Socket
- Team plan requires minimum 5-developer commitment, expensive for small teams
- Business plan $50/dev/month becomes costly for teams exceeding 20 members
- Enterprise pricing requires custom consultation with no transparent pricing
- Free plan limited to individual developers without team collaboration
- Reachability analysis improvement (90% false positive reduction) only on Enterprise
Chainguard
- Containers Catalog at 19,000 USD/year expensive for teams under 10 people
- Per-image pricing for containers requires custom quotes with no transparency
- Free tier limited to 5 container images for testing
- Libraries pricing by ecosystem and developer count lacks transparent per-developer cost
- VM image catalog pricing opacity makes cost estimation difficult
Pricing, plan by plan
Socket
Free- FreeFree
- For individual developers
- Detects 70+ risk types
- Blocks malicious dependencies automatically
- Team$25/month
- Per developer on minimum 5 developers
- Precomputed reachability analysis cuts 60% false positives
- Slack alerts for threats
- Business$50/month
- Per developer on minimum 20 developers
- All Team features
- Compliance integrations with Vanta
- Enterprise$undefined/custom
- Function-level reachability eliminates up to 90% irrelevant CVEs
- Multi-repository system support
- Named account manager
Chainguard
Free- Free TierFree
- Five container images to test and deploy
- Containers Per-Image$undefined/custom
- Licensed by quantity and type
- Base images, application images, AI/ML images, FIPS variants
- Custom pricing per image
- Containers Catalog$19000/year
- For 10-person engineering teams
- 2,000+ container images
- Contractual CVE remediation SLAs
- Libraries Licensing$undefined/custom
- Licensed by ecosystem (Python, Java, JavaScript)
- Licensed by developer count
- Unlimited pulls with no metering

Answered from the vendors’ own pages
Socket: How many zero-day attacks does Socket detect?
Socket detects over 100 zero-day attacks weekly across JavaScript, Python, and Go ecosystems.
SourceChainguard: How much is the Chainguard Containers Catalog?
The Containers Catalog is 19,000 USD per year for 10-person engineering teams, providing access to 2,000+ hardened container images.
SourceSocket: What is precomputed reachability analysis?
Socket's precomputed reachability analysis cuts CVE false positives by 60% automatically on Team plans, and up to 90% on Enterprise plans through function-level analysis.
SourceChainguard: What SLAs does Chainguard offer?
Chainguard provides contractual CVE remediation SLAs: 7 days for critical vulnerabilities, 14 days for high/medium/low severity, all with priority support.
SourceSocket: Is there a discount for annual billing?
Yes. Socket offers a 20% discount for annual commitments across all subscription tiers.
SourceChainguard: Can I try Chainguard before purchasing?
Yes. The free tier includes five container images for testing and deployment, allowing hands-on evaluation.
